just starting in the past few weeks myself with chickens, this is what I learned (thank goodness for the poor birds sake) one always have water available at all times, two keep a heatlamp to the side of a enclosure so it dont get to hot and if they get hot they can move to the other side of the pen, third always handle them gently and early otherwise you may end up with skittish older chicks like mine who dont mind me standing and feeding and do things just dont reach and touch them they flee, I have done everything I can to gain their trust, I am a failure at this, I also learned about diamatomous earth for internal and external parasites, about grit, I also have a fully practically predator proof coop for them at night, they have dark shade underneath the shed, they have a tree overhead for shade, always use plenty of bedding and I like to use that coop deoderant beads, they rae made of organix things like bran etc. to absorb oders, but still have not found a sifting fork with prongs close enough to sift the poop from the bedding so I dont have to do a comlete clean out every few days. plastic is my least favorite materail to use for any animal, I like the lid idea tho, that keeps predators like cats and dogs that are nosy out and protect from overheating too.
